How they compare
Jordan currently reports 10,818 against 8,986 in Serbia, a difference of 1,832.
That makes Jordan's figure about 1.2 times Serbia's.
Across all 9 years both countries report, Jordan has been ahead every year.
Jordan ranks 81st and Serbia ranks 84th of 163 countries.
Jordan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
